Abstract :
The length of discrete signals could be very long in many real applications. In such case, the existing DCT-based real-valued discrete Gabor transform (RGDT) for finite sequences is no longer adequate. In this paper, the novel DCT-based RGDT for infinite sequences is defined and the biorthogonality relationship between the analysis window and the synthesis window for the novel transform is also provided. Because the novel transform only involves real operations and can utilize fast DCT and IDCT algorithms for fast computation, it is easier in computation and implementation by hardware or software as compared to the traditional complex-valued discrete Gabor transform.
